Stopover by Bruce Connew


With short story by Brij Lal
Published by Victoria University Press and University of Hawaii Press, 2007


A note on the cover: Stopover is a social / political art document that tells the story of Indian-Fijian migration, imposed by a succession of coups, ensuing racism and economic hardship. The cover typography represents this migration to first-world cities — the “O”s move to the back cover, silver-filled.
